SEADATANET. SeaDataNet is a standardised system for managing the large and diverse data sets collected by oceanographic fleets and automatic observation systems. The SeaDataNet infrastructure networks and enhances the extant infrastructure of national oceanographic data centres of 35 countries. The second phase of SeaDataNet (SeaDataNet 2 project, started on October 1st, 2011 for a duration of 4 years) aims to upgrade the present SeaDataNet infrastructure into an operationally robust and state-of-the-art Pan-European infrastructure for providing up-to-date and high quality access to ocean and marine metadata, data and data products by :  setting, adopting and promoting common data management standards  realising technical and semantic interoperability with other relevant data management systems and initiatives on behalf of science, environmental management, policy making, and economy

SEADATANET. Each contributing data centre has its own responsibility regarding contribution to SEADATANET, requiring creation and uploading of Common Data Index (CDI) metadata records for each data set. The input required for additional resource beyond that needed for the best practise of the FixO3 data policy, although encouraged, will be limited by centre resource. The relationship of the SEADATANET records to other data sources (eg OceanSITES) is not simple, with a change in data granularity often occurring. The data observatories that currently upload CDI records to SEADATANET are: DYFAMED, E2-M3A, E1- M3A, MOMAR and PYLOS. Other data centres are working to deliver their data to SEADATANET as part of wider commitments to the SEADATANET project.
